Key inclusion & exclusion criteria
|
Inclusion Criteria:
- Patient must be enrolled on an RTOG GBM study that prescribes 6000 cGy of radiation therapy.
- Patient must meet the eligibility requirements for the RTOG treatment study. (If the patient is deemed retrospectively ineligible for the RTOG treatment study, the patient will likewise be ineligible for this study.)
- Patient must sign a study-specific informed consent for RTOG 0611 prior to study entry.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Patient not able to receive 6000 cGy of radiation therapy.
Age minimum:
18 Years
Age maximum:
N/A
Gender:
Both
